Output 63c5e821d8de9c1d7dbccac1da1281458c40f3fff8fad2061271ce64acce5226:47

value
1325000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09bdb7800b709ffe6da69f26da6ff739adad610e OP_EQUAL
address
32aXH2NP2WA41m32ZJsyKT1eqbb6trAHo9
transaction
63c5e821d8de9c1d7dbccac1da1281458c40f3fff8fad2061271ce64acce5226
spent
true